The increased lifetime demanded of state-of-the-art telecommunications satellites has necessitated the tribological redesign of an electric thruster pointing mechanism which is currently used in-orbit on the scientific ESA telecom satellite ARTEMIS. The change from dry to liquid lubrication will be described and results of in-vacuo tests under oscillatory motion will be presented. The tests were performed both at Austrian Aerospace (Austria) and at ESTL (UK). Results of strip-down inspections will be described and the lessons learned stated.
Roller screw lifetime under oscillatory motion: From dry to liquid lubrication
